The Riau Natural Resources Conservation Agency (BBKSDA Riau) received the skull and ivory tusk of a Sumatran elephant (Elephas maximus sumatranus) from the District Court last month. The elephant's carcass were evidences in a hunting case .
Last year, the critically endangered mammal fell victim to hunting in Kelayang, Indragiri Hulu regency, Riau. The Rengat District Court later sentenced two elephant poachers to three years in prison, as well as a Rp 100 million ($6,997) fine or a subsidiary imprisonment of six months.
